How do I retrieve archived emails in Gmail?
You can recover archived emails by entering this search operator in Gmail’s search bar: -label:inbox -label:sent -label:drafts -label:notes -in:Chats. Then press the blue search button. That will filter out sent emails, inbox emails, drafts, notes and chats as shown in the snapshot below.
Can you access archived Gmail emails?
To view and restore archived emails on Gmail app (Android), follow these steps: Open Gmail app on your android phone. Go to Menu tab and click on “All Mail”. Messages without inbox label are archived emails or find your desired emails on the search bar. Select the messages that you want to retrieve.
Where are archived messages in Gmail?
When you archive a message in Gmail, it’s removed from your inbox and transferred into the All Mail folder. To find an archived message, open the All Mail folder and use Gmail’s search functionality to filter its contents.
